(ANSA) - LONDON, MARCH 5 - Abduction of children, torture of one of them, threats to ex-wife: the accusations certified by the British High Court judges who have sentenced Mohammed Bin Rashid Al-Maktoum, powerful and rich Emir of Dubai, are very heavy in the divorce case and on the family custody brought 8 months ago against him by the now ex-wife, Princess Haya of Jordan, fled adolescently from the Emirates to take refuge in London. The outcome of the dispute had been decided after a series of prejudices all in favor of Haya, issued starting from the end of 2019, but the Emir had attempted to prevent the reasons from being known from the area: a request that in the end the British justice rejected, publishing today the device for "public interest" reasons. Not without reproaching the Emirate prince - an iron ally of the United States and the United Kingdom, and also protected by total immunity against any hypothetical criminal consequence - of "not having been open or honest to the court" judge.
